Innovating Personal Safety: The Rise of Smart Security Ecosystems

In an era increasingly defined by technological integration, personal safety and security have undergone transformative shifts. Traditional security measures—such as standalone alarm systems and basic surveillance—are rapidly giving way to interconnected ecosystems that leverage the Internet of Things (IoT), artificial intelligence, and cloud computing. This evolution not only enhances real-time responsiveness but also empowers users with unprecedented control and insight over their safety environments.

The Convergence of Security Technologies and Data-Driven Insights

Modern security solutions now encompass a comprehensive array of devices: smart cameras, motion sensors, biometric access controls, and wearable safety gadgets. A critical advantage of this integration is the empowered data flow—it enables nuanced analysis, predictive alerts, and tailored responses. As a result, security providers can preempt threats, rather than merely react to incidents after they occur.

Traditional Security Approach Modern Integrated Ecosystem
Standalone systems with limited connectivity Interconnected devices with centralised control
Reactive incident management Predictive analytics & preemptive alerts
Manual oversight Automated, AI-powered decision-making

Crucially, this shift relies on seamlessly integrating hardware with sophisticated software platforms that aggregate and interpret vast datasets. Ensuring data privacy and system resilience remains paramount, given the sensitive nature of personal safety information.

The Industry Outlook: Building Trust Through Transparency and Data Integrity

As these sophisticated ecosystems evolve, industry leaders emphasize a collaborative approach—balancing technological capabilities with strict adherence to data privacy standards. Standardisation efforts and interoperability protocols are essential to avoid vendor lock-in and ensure user trust.

Furthermore, cybersecurity remains a cornerstone, as malicious actors increasingly target connected systems. Employing multi-layered cybersecurity measures, such as end-to-end encryption, regular software updates, and behaviour-based threat detection, is now standard practice.
